Biocompatible Coatings Market Size and Forecast 2026-2033

The Biocompatible Coatings Market was valued at USD 2.5 billion in 2024 and is projected to reach USD 4.8 billion by 2033, exhibiting a compound annual growth rate (CAGR) of approximately 8.2% from 2025 to 2033. This growth trajectory reflects increasing adoption across medical device manufacturing, implantable devices, and tissue engineering applications, driven by stringent regulatory standards and technological advancements. The expanding global healthcare infrastructure, coupled with rising prevalence of chronic diseases requiring implantable solutions, underscores the market’s robust expansion. Additionally, innovations in nanocoatings and smart biocompatible materials are further fueling market penetration strategies. As regulatory frameworks evolve to emphasize biocompatibility and safety, industry stakeholders are prioritizing high-performance, compliant coatings to meet market demands.

What is Biocompatible Coatings Market?

The Biocompatible Coatings Market encompasses the development, manufacturing, and deployment of specialized surface coatings designed to enhance the compatibility of medical devices and implants with human tissue. These coatings serve to minimize adverse biological reactions, such as inflammation or rejection, while improving device performance, durability, and functionality. They are formulated using advanced materials like polymers, ceramics, and composites that meet rigorous regulatory standards for safety and efficacy. The market is driven by the need for innovative solutions that address complex medical challenges, including infection control, corrosion resistance, and tissue integration. As the healthcare industry advances toward personalized and minimally invasive treatments, biocompatible coatings are becoming integral to next-generation medical technologies.

Key Market Restraints

Despite promising growth prospects, the Biocompatible Coatings Market faces several challenges that could impede its trajectory. High R&D costs and complex regulatory approval processes pose significant barriers for new entrants and existing manufacturers aiming to innovate. Variability in biocompatibility standards across regions complicates global market expansion and compliance efforts. Additionally, the limited long-term data on the durability and performance of emerging coating materials raises concerns among healthcare providers and regulators. The scarcity of skilled personnel proficient in advanced coating technologies further hampers adoption. Environmental and safety concerns related to certain chemical constituents in coatings also necessitate rigorous scrutiny, potentially delaying product launches and increasing costs.
